> > o only enable cpufreq options if power management is selected
> > o don't put cpufreq options in a separate submenu
>
> Yes, but what I do not understand is why cpufreq need power management.

Because it is a power management option. :)

CONFIG_PM is a dummy option, it does not link any code into the kernel
by itself.
